The History of Cloggs

Cloggs have a rich history that dates back centuries. Originally designed for agricultural workers, these shoes were made from wood and offered both durability and comfort. The earliest known cloggs were found in regions of Europe, particularly in the Netherlands and Scandinavia. As time passed, cloggs evolved into various styles and materials, becoming a staple in many cultures.

The industrial revolution brought about significant changes in footwear manufacturing, and cloggs adapted to these new techniques. By the 20th century, cloggs had transitioned into fashionable items, often seen on runways and in casual settings. Today, they are embraced by individuals seeking both comfort and style.

Types of Cloggs

Cloggs come in various styles and materials, catering to different preferences and needs. Below, we will explore three of the most popular types of cloggs.

Wooden Cloggs

Wooden cloggs are the traditional form, often associated with their rustic charm. Made from solid wood, these shoes provide excellent support and durability. They are popular among those who value a classic aesthetic and enjoy the natural feel of wood underfoot.

Leather Cloggs

Leather cloggs offer a more refined look while still maintaining comfort. These shoes come in various styles, from casual to formal. Leather is known for its breathability and flexibility, making it a popular choice for everyday wear.

Rubber Cloggs

Rubber cloggs are perfect for those who need waterproof footwear. They are lightweight, easy to clean, and ideal for outdoor activities. Rubber cloggs are often favored by professionals in fields such as healthcare and hospitality due to their practicality.

Caring for Your Cloggs

To prolong the life of your cloggs, proper care is essential. Here are some maintenance tips:

  • Clean Regularly: Wipe down your cloggs after each use to remove dirt and debris.
  • Condition Leather: Use leather conditioner to keep the material supple and prevent cracking.
  • Store Properly: Keep cloggs in a cool, dry place to avoid moisture damage.

Several brands are renowned for their high-quality cloggs. Some of the most popular include:

  • Dansko: Known for their professional-grade cloggs, ideal for those in the healthcare industry.
  • Birkenstock: Offers a range of comfortable cloggs with their signature footbed.
  • Clarks: Known for stylish and durable cloggs suitable for various occasions.
